WebDiscipline Code Discipline Code The Discipline Code is also known as the Citywide Behavioral Expectations to Support Student Learning. It: Is age-specific with one set for grades K-5 and another for grades 6-12. Explains the standards for behavior in the New York City public schools.

Webcyberbullying problem because school authorities are in the best position to observe student conduct. Schools traditionally discipline bullies for their behavior, and they might provide resources for counseling of both bullies and victims. Cyberbullying done on or off campus, however, may not amount to a crime, such as stalking.
